ScribbleJ Posted October 26, 2009 Posted October 26, 2009 It's so annoying trying to delete items on that layer during drawing cleanup (when you isolate it, you can't click on any of the entities so you have to screw around freezing/turning off everything else then deleting/moving the items, etc.). I think it is probably just old school having a hard time letting go myself. I find myself being guilty of this even though our standards manager has a layer in it for no plot layers. One thing I noticed about your OP is the quote above. Are you aware that if layer zero is frozen or turned off it will prevent you from selecting the ones on defpoints? That is why you can't clean them up if your using layer isolate. Defpoints was created for dimensions back in the day for the insertion point (i.e. nodes) of extension lines so I don't see it going away in the future. Quote

rkent Posted October 26, 2009 Posted October 26, 2009 I don't use them but I can see if someone wants to ensure the info doesn't get plotted then put it on defpoints. There is no way to plot what is on defpoints but someone could toggle off the noplot very easily. Quote
